    The Sacramento–San Joaquin River Delta, or California Delta, is an expansive inland river delta and estuary in Northern California.The Delta is formed at the western edge of the Central Valley by the confluence of the Sacramento and San Joaquin rivers and lies just east of where the rivers enter Suisun Bay.The Delta is recognized for protection by the California Bays and Estuaries Policy.

    The Sacramento-San Joaquin Delta plays a major role in California's prosperity by supplying drinking water to 25 million residents and fueling a $32 billion agricultural industry. It also serves as important habitat to more than 750 animal and plant species, including more than 40 aquatic species.
